How Much Does Shower Installation Cost In NZ?

Are you considering upgrading your shower but find yourself questioning the expenses involved? The cost of shower installation in New Zealand can vary significantly depending on numerous factors. From the type of materials you choose to the complexity of the installation process, there are several aspects that can impact the overall cost. Understanding these variables and knowing how to navigate them can help you make informed decisions and potentially save you money.

Factors Affecting Shower Installation Costs:

1. Type of Shower: The type of shower you choose significantly impacts the overall cost. Options range from basic shower kits to custom-designed showers with intricate features. Basic shower kits are typically more affordable, while custom showers can be more expensive due to the additional labor and materials required.

2. Size and Complexity: The size and complexity of the shower installation project also play a significant role in determining the cost. Larger showers or those with custom features such as multiple showerheads, built-in seating, or intricate tile work will require more time and materials, thus increasing the overall cost.

3. Materials: The materials used for the shower installation, including shower pans, walls, tiles, fixtures, and plumbing fittings, contribute to the total cost. Higher-quality materials will generally cost more upfront but may offer better durability and aesthetic appeal in the long run.

4. Labor Costs: Labor costs are a significant component of shower installation expenses. Factors such as the skill level of the installer, location, and project complexity can affect labor rates. Custom showers or projects requiring extensive plumbing work may require more labor and, consequently, incur higher costs.

5. Permits and Regulations: Depending on your location in New Zealand, you may need to obtain permits for shower installation projects. Permit fees and regulatory requirements can vary, adding to the overall cost of the project. It’s essential to research local building codes and regulations to ensure compliance and avoid potential fines or delays.

6. Additional Features: Additional features such as built-in shelves, niches, grab bars, or steam functionality can enhance the functionality and aesthetics of your shower but may also add to the overall cost. Consider your preferences and budget carefully when selecting optional features for your shower installation project.

Average Cost of Shower Materials

When renovating your bathroom, you can expect to spend an average of $500 to $2,000 on shower materials. This cost range includes items such as the shower pan, walls, doors, fixtures, and any tiling or waterproofing materials needed for the project.

The price can vary based on the quality of materials you choose, the size of your shower space, and any additional features like built-in shelving or seating. Opting for budget-friendly options may lower costs, but investing in higher-end materials can enhance the overall look and durability of your shower.

It’s essential to consider your preferences, budget, and long-term satisfaction when selecting the materials for your shower renovation.

Labor Charges for Shower Installation

Labor charges for shower installation in New Zealand typically range from $800 to $3,000. This cost variation is influenced by factors like installation complexity, location, and the tradesperson’s experience. Hiring a professional for shower installation is advisable as it ensures correct and efficient job completion. Despite the temptation to DIY for cost-saving purposes, improper installation may result in expensive repairs later on. To find the right tradesperson, research local professionals, request quotes, and specifically ask about their shower installation expertise. Gathering multiple quotes not only helps in securing a competitive price but also guarantees quality workmanship for your new shower.

Additional Costs to Consider

Considering the labor charges for shower installation in New Zealand, it’s essential to factor in additional costs that may arise during the process. Some common additional expenses to consider include materials such as tiles, grout, waterproofing materials, and fixtures like showerheads and faucets. Depending on the complexity of the installation, you might also need to budget for plumbing modifications or electrical work.

If your existing plumbing or electrical systems are outdated or not up to code, the cost of bringing them up to standard should be considered. It’s wise to set aside a contingency fund for unexpected issues that may arise during the installation to ensure a smooth and hassle-free process.

Factors Influencing Installation Expenses

Factors such as the complexity of the design and the quality of materials significantly impact shower installation expenses in New Zealand. The intricacy of your chosen shower design plays a crucial role in determining the final cost. Elaborate patterns, custom fittings, or non-standard layouts often require more time and expertise, leading to higher installation charges.

Additionally, the quality of materials selected for your shower installation directly affects the overall expenses. Opting for premium materials like high-end tiles, luxury fixtures, or custom glass enclosures will result in a higher total cost. By carefully considering these factors and discussing them with your installer, you can better understand how they influence the price of your shower installation project.

Tips for Managing Shower Installation Costs:

  • Set a Realistic Budget: Before embarking on a shower installation project, assess your finances and set a realistic budget that accounts for all potential expenses, including materials, labor, permits, and contingencies.
  • Shop Around for Quotes: Obtain quotes from multiple contractors or shower installation companies to compare prices and services. Be sure to ask about any additional fees or charges to ensure transparency and avoid unexpected costs.
  • Consider Long-Term Value: While it may be tempting to opt for the cheapest option upfront, consider the long-term value of investing in high-quality materials and skilled labor. A well-installed shower using durable materials can provide years of enjoyment and may require fewer repairs or replacements down the line.
  • Plan Ahead: Planning ahead and scheduling your shower installation during off-peak times or slower seasons can sometimes result in lower labor costs. Additionally, having a clear vision of your desired shower design and features from the outset can help streamline the installation process and minimize costly changes or revisions.
